A coordination guide for multiple software agents that read and change the same shared information at the same time.

In plain words
What is it for?
Use it to define shared data, control which agent may change each part, and coordinate distributed collection or recovery after a failure.
Why use it?
It helps prevent race conditions, silent overwrites, and results that change unpredictably when agents work in parallel.

Agent State Synchronizer

Quand utiliser ce skill

Utilise ce skill quand plusieurs agents accèdent et modifient un état commun en parallèle : collecte distribuée, workflows coordinés, récupération après panne. Sans synchronisation explicite : race conditions, écrasements silencieux, résultats non déterministes.


Workflow en 8 étapes

1. Définir le shared state (schéma minimal)

Ne partager que ce qui est nécessaire à la coordination — pas l'état interne de chaque agent.

from pydantic import BaseModel
from typing import Any
from datetime import datetime

class SharedState(BaseModel):
    version: int = 0
    schema_version: str = "1.0"
    task_assignments: dict[str, str] = {}   # task_id → agent_id
    task_results: dict[str, Any] = {}        # task_id → result
    agent_status: dict[str, str] = {}        # agent_id → "idle"|"working"|"done"|"error"
    global_context: dict[str, Any] = {}      # lecture seule pour tous
    last_updated: datetime = datetime.utcnow()
    last_updated_by: str = ""

Critères de design :

  • READ_ALL / WRITE_OWN — chaque agent n'écrit que ses propres champs → moins de conflits.
  • Fine-grained (un verrou par champ) vs coarse-grained (un seul verrou global) : préférer fine-grained sauf si les transactions multi-champs sont fréquentes.
  • Versionner le schéma (schema_version) dès le départ pour faciliter les migrations.

2. Choisir le state store

Store Cas d'usage Avantages Limites
Dict Python Mono-process, tests Ultra-rapide, zéro infra Pas de persistance, un seul process
Redis Multi-process, dev/prod Atomic ops, pub/sub, TTL natif Consistance éventuelle par défaut
PostgreSQL Persistance forte requise ACID, SELECT FOR UPDATE Plus lent, surcharge opérationnelle
Event log Auditabilité, replay Immuable, debuggable Reconstruction de l'état coûteuse

Recommandation : Redis pour la majorité des systèmes multi-agents en 2026.
